Our client is seeking an experienced and driven BSA Officer to lead the US AML team as they embark on a critical phase of growth and expansion. Reporting to the Head of Risk Compliance and managing a team of investigators, this role is central to ensuring robust compliance with all financial crime regulatory requirements, particularly in the rapidly evolving crypto space. The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in financial crime operations, a proven track record of managing teams, a strong ability to optimize workflows and processes, and an appetite for operating in an ambitious, high-growth environment.

Key Responsibilities:

Leadership Team Management:

  • Manage and grow the Financial Crime Operations team, fostering a culture of collaboration, excellence, and accountability.
  • Support organizational workforce management projects, including capacity planning and resource allocation across multiple jurisdictions.
  • Liaise with financial partners as needed for reporting and other joint risk management efforts.

Operations Ownership:

  • Own transaction monitoring rules and alerting systems, handling testing and tuning to calibrate results appropriately and ensure effective, efficient risk detection.
  • Optimize and manage complex alert flows from triage to reporting, working with financial crimes operation staff to ensure thorough and timely investigations and keeping SLAs within targets.
  • Lead the development and implementation of Enhanced Due Diligence (EDD) and customer risk scoring methodologies and associated processes.
  • Ensure workflow efficiency by identifying and driving process optimization and technology enhancements in collaboration with the Product and Engineering teams.
  • Develop and maintain a comprehensive procedural library, training materials, and other resources as needed to support operational activities.

Compliance Governance Support:

  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of industry trends, typologies, and regulatory requirements, with a focus on cryptocurrency and consumer payments.
  • Assist with compliance governance functions, including Policy, Risk Assessment, and Training.

Qualifications:

  • At least 7 years of experience in financial crime operations, with a strong focus on BSA/AML compliance and risk management.
  • At least 4 years of experience managing teams in a financial crime compliance operations setting.
  • Expertise in consumer payments and/or cryptocurrency-related compliance challenges and typologies.
  • Proven ability to manage workflows efficiently and effectively.
  • Strong communication and leadership skills, with experience collaborating across functions and presenting to senior stakeholders.

Preferred Skills:

  • Experience with on-chain investigative tools and techniques.
  • Advanced certifications in financial crimes compliance and fraud, such as CAMS, CFCS, or CFE.
  • Familiarity with compliance technology solutions and workforce management tools.
